Renaming a Project or Folder
1. Choose [MENU]Ú<FINDER>.
2. Touch the name of the project or folder that you want to
rename.
3. Touch <RENAME>.
4. Touch the arrow keys to move the cursor to the location at
which you want to insert a character.
5. Touch the letter keys to enter characters.
Each time you touch a letter key, the character will change in the
order of A, B, and C. Touch <Type> to switch between uppercase,
lowercase, and numerals.
Touch <Del> to delete the character at the cursor location.
To conrm the edited name, touch <OK>.
If you decide to cancel, touch <CANCEL>.
MEMO
• On the R-88, you can only rename le names that consist of
ASCII characters (single-byte alphanumeric characters).
• You cannot rename a le name that contains double-byte
characters such as Japanese.
• If an identical name already exists, the screen will indicate
“Already Exists.” Please specify a dierent name.
• You won’t be able to delete all the characters. There will always
be one remaining character.
Characters that can be used
(space) ! # $ % & ‘ ( ) + , - . 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 ; = @
A B C D E F G H I J K L M N O P Q R S T U V W X Y Z ] ^ _ `
a b c d e f g h i j k l m n o p q r s t u v w x y z { }
Viewing Information About the
Project
1. Choose [MENU]Ú<FINDER>.
2. Touch the name of the project whose information you
want to view.
3. Touch <INFO>.
Protecting a Project (Protect)
You can protect a project so that it cannot be erased or renamed
accidentally.
1. Choose [MENU]Ú<FINDER>.
2. Touch the name of the project that you want to protect.
3. Touch <INFO>.
4. Touch <NO>.
MEMO
If you turn Protect on, a lock icon is displayed.
* To disable protection, touch <YES> in step 4.
